Hi all. I was carrying out a small operation (or so I thought!) of
removing a machine from one of the groups because it is no longer part
of the network, when the website seemed to crash; The "Ok" button was
stuck pressed in and I could not do anything. I left it like that for a
while thinking there was probably just a server lag to read an email or
two, but 5 minutes later it was still the same. I ended the IE process
and relogged in to the site, to see that the main page was stuck on
refreshing and then a few minutes later gave me the error "Error
connecting to the Windows Server Update Services database". I then
proceeded to restart the SQL service MSSQL$WSUS, which also caused
AgentSQL$WSUS to restart as well. Thereafter, I refreshed my browser
and the site seemed to be alright. But then as I was going through the
computer listing I noticed that it was showing less machines. Infact,
the figurers in the groups were very similar, or even same as to what
it looked like before I added a second network card to the server so
that it could detect workstations on another IP network of the same
windows domain.

I would like to know if this crash has compromised WSUS's ability to
redetect the machines that have been "lost", and/or what steps I could
take to bring the listing up-to-date.
